    Branded Nutrition: Brandie Trimble

    Brandie Trimble seeks to make a mark in the community by offering more than just a workout to her clients. Although dually certified in both personal and functional training, Brandie's passion arrowheads in combining food with balanced nutrition and activity you love to help you build a sustainable program that leaves you feeling empowered. Her focus is to help clients build a program they can manage despite schedule and time restraints and teach them ways to rethink food- not diet.


    Brandie holds a degree in Health Science from UF and has subsequent certifications in Sports Nutrition, Exercise Therapy, Autoimmune Conditions and Group Fitness. She began her journey in fitness when she faced a Lupus diagnosis that gave a prognosis she wasn't ok with. Through years of experience on her own journey to healing through food, as well as countless client journeys, Brandie hopes to brand a form of fitness that leaves lifestyle the only option around. She is building a brand that helps to show women how to feel better with the power of nutrition, think clearer by educating them on their own bodies and what works best for them and how to own where they are in order to help them live with quality and longevity.

    A local native of the Bartow, FL area, Star Tollie is the Founder + Creative Director of Rejuvenation Home Studio. She leads a support staff to produce rejuvenated spaces and give deeper meaning to each and every interior. Interior design found her. She stumbled across her passion for interior design in her grandmother's renovated garage. Star graduated from the International Academy of Design and Technology and worked for several design firms to perfect her craft before deciding to branch out on her own. She is dedicated to refining her craft and giving new energy to the soul of every project. She is responsible for creating functional interiors with the intention of influencing the quality of life of its occupants through artful beauty, visual excitement, materiality, and quality craftmanship.

    Gerri Kramer serves as the Chief Communications Officer for the Hillsborough County Supervisor of Elections. Every day, her goal is to empower Hillsborough County citizens to vote by providing basic "where, when and how" information about voting, as well as working to inspire confidence in the integrity of our elections. In her role, Gerri leads voter education and outreach efforts by working with local media outlets, engaging community partners, managing social media accounts and the VoteHillsborough.gov website, and sharing information with voters through marketing, advertising and direct mail. Gerri joined the Hillsborough County Supervisor of Elections Office in 2013, just after Supervisor of Elections Craig Latimer was elected to office. She brought with her more than 25 years of communications and public relations experience in the public and private sector. Gerri is a 2016 graduate of the Leadership Tampa and serves on Leadership Tampa

    Alumni’s outreach committee. She earned her degree in Public Policy from Duke University.
